Transaction edda113a24f1058eeafb62db7257431333552674a8136c7bc679034d97678ad9
1 Input
1 Output
-
edda113a24f1058eeafb62db7257431333552674a8136c7bc679034d97678ad9:0
- value
- 1345520
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5594c72b5ba5b9370bba5c409d07ce418ba69683 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18oWfanwRQ7qeuCbfsPhSQkafdwZAvftMV